The Brazilian State Funding Agencies, articulated by its National Council (CONFAP), and the Royal Society, under the Newton Fund, invite applications for their research mobility grants. These enable UK researchers to develop the strengths and capabilities of their research groups through training, collaboration and reciprocal visits with partners in research groups in Brazil. Research may be in any field of natural sciences, engineering, medical sciences, including clinical or patient-oriented research, social sciences and humanities. Four types of grants are available:
•for UK researchers receiving support from a funding agency outside the state of São Paolo for missions up to 15 days, covering airfares, travel insurance and daily support;
•for UK researchers receiving support from a funding agency outside the state of São Paolo for missions from 16 days up to three months, covering airfares, travel insurance and a monthly scholarship of BRL 7,000;
•for UK researchers receiving support from an institute in the state of São Paolo for missions from seven days up to one month, covering airfares, travel insurance and daily support;
•for UK researchers receiving support from an institute in the state of São Paolo for missions from one month up to 12 months, covering airfares, travel insurance and a monthly scholarship worth up to BRL 10,680 for young researchers and up to BRL 15,870 for full professors.
The applicants must hold a PhD and a permanent academic post or postdoctoral positions in the UK which extends beyond the period of the award. Young researchers must be within two to seven years from their PhD, and senior researchers must have hold a PhD for over seven years. Applications must include a Brazilian-based collaborator as a co-applicant.
